The equipment abnormalities can be detected by analyzing and diagnosing the vibration data.

Vibrations can be easily analyzed for predictive maintenance while keeping initial costs low

The e-F@ctory Starter Package includes sample projects for the MELSEC iQ-R Series and the GOT2000 Series.
This package enables general vibration analysis, including frequency analysis and vibration intensity monitoring of each frequency band, allowing it to be used for various equipment.

● Suitable equipment

Equipment where changes in vibration when abnormalities occur, such as glass cutting equipment or grinders.

Diagnose the rotating mechanisms of equipment with minimal knowledge about vibration analysis and diagnosis

Projects which have been verified to work with MELSEC iQ-R Series and GOT2000 Series are provided as a package.
Simply connect the necessary devices, install the programs and screen data in the package, and detect abnormalities in equipment with rotating mechanisms by making only the necessary settings. The location of abnormalities can also be assessed with a precise diagnosis.
